Vat Savitri Puja is one of the most beautiful Hindu festivals celebrating love, loyalty, sacrifice, and devotion between husband and wife.
It originated from the story of Savitri and Satyavan from the Mahabharata.
Savitri was a devoted wife whose husband Satyavan was destined to die at a young age. When Yamraj came to take Satyavan’s soul, Savitri followed him with courage, wisdom, and unwavering devotion. Impressed by her dedication and intelligence, Yamraj granted Satyavan his life back.
That’s why married Hindu women observe Vat Savitri fast and worship the Banyan tree (Vat Vriksha), which symbolizes long life, strength, and stability.

Her name is Aradhana Prakash.
She was 14 years old in August 1990. Ruchika Girhotra’s best friend. A fellow tennis trainee at the Haryana Lawn Tennis Association.
She was in the room when S P S Rathore called them both to his office. He sent her out on a pretext. When she returned she found Ruchika distressed.
She was the sole eyewitness. The only person who could testify to what happened that day.
For 19 years Rathore tried to silence her.
He filed civil case after civil case against her family. Cases against journalists covering the story. Cases against the lawyers fighting it.
Ruchika died in December 1993. Her father and brother were harassed so badly they had to leave Panchkula entirely.
Aradhana and her parents stayed.
Her father Anand Prakash and mother Madhu Prakash attended over 400 hearings across 19 years. Every single one. They never settled. They were never intimidated.
The court found Aradhana’s testimony unimpeachable. The judgment relied on her as the sole witness to convict Rathore in December 2009.
When Rathore was attacked outside court by a member of the public she went on television and asked people not to take the law into their own hands. She said that for 19 years they had always worked within the law.
Her father Anand Prakash died of prostate cancer in January 2018 aged 74. He had attended more than 400 hearings. He lived long enough to see Rathore convicted. He did not live long enough to see justice feel complete.

Her name is Pratiksha Tondwalkar.
She was born in 1964 in Pune into a Scheduled Caste family.
When she was in Class 7, her father decided to pull her out of school and get her married. Her teacher begged him to let her continue. She even offered to pay for Pratiksha’s education herself. Her father refused.
She was married at 17. Her husband Sadashiv Kadu worked as a bookbinder at a Mumbai branch of the State Bank of India.
When she was 20, he died in a road accident. She was left with a two year old son and no education.
She walked into the same SBI branch to collect her late husband’s dues. She told the bank she needed any job they could give her.
They gave her a broom.
She swept floors. She dusted furniture. She cleaned restrooms. She earned Rs 65 a month.
She said in an interview whenever my son asked for a packet of biscuits I would get off the bus one stop early just to save the fare money to buy them for him.
After work, she enrolled in night college in Vikhroli. She completed Class 10 with first class marks. Then Class 12. Then a psychology degree. Bank colleagues helped her study whenever they could.
Her parents pressured her to remarry immediately. She refused until she had graduated.
She was promoted from sweeper to messenger to clerk.
She remarried in 1993. Her husband Pramod Tondwalkar encouraged her to take the banking officer exams. She cleared them.
She rose from trainee officer to Scale 4 to Chief General Manager.
In 2022, she became Assistant General Manager of the State Bank of India.
The same bank where she once cleaned restrooms for Rs 65 a month gave her its highest management honour 40 years later.

Her name is Malavika Hegde.
In July 2019, her husband VG Siddhartha walked onto a bridge near Mangalore and told his driver he would be back shortly.
He never came back.
Siddhartha had built Cafe Coffee Day into India’s largest coffee chain. 1700 cafes. 25000 employees. He had also buried the company under Rs 7214 crore of debt.
The board panicked. Analysts wrote CCD off.
Nobody had accounted for Malavika.
She was an engineer. A mother of two. She had never run a company in her life. Her father SM Krishna was a former Chief Minister of Karnataka. She could have lived in that shadow comfortably.
She chose the debt instead.
In December 2020, she took over as CEO. In the middle of a pandemic. Her first act was a personal letter to all 25000 employees. She wrote the CCD story is worth preserving. I will fight for this brand.
Then she got to work.
She called every lender personally and renegotiated terms. She sold Global Village Tech Park to Blackstone. She closed every loss making outlet. She exported premium Arabica beans from her own 20000 acre farm to international markets to generate fresh revenue.
She never raised the price of a single cup of coffee.
By 2021, the debt was down to Rs 1731 crore. By 2023, it was Rs 465 crore.
A 93 percent reduction in four years.
Today, CCD runs 423 cafes and 55733 vending machines across India. Netflix is developing a web series on her life. Business schools are teaching her turnaround as a case study.
